A New Internet-Draft is available from the on-line Internet-Drafts directories.
This draft is a work item of the Transport Area Working Group Working Group of the IETF.

	Title		: A Conservative SACK-based Loss Recovery Algorithm for 
                          TCP
	Author(s)	: E. Blanton, M. Allman, K. Fall
	Filename	: draft-allman-tcp-sack-11.txt
	Pages		: 9
	Date		: 05-Jul-02
	
This document presents a conservative loss recovery algorithm
for TCP that is based on the use of the selective acknowledgment
TCP option.  The algorithm presented in this document conforms
to the spirit of the current congestion control specification
[RFC2581], but allows TCP senders to recover more effectively
when multiple segments are lost from a single flight of data.
